WebJul 18, 2024 · The diaphysis is a tube with a hollow center called the medullary cavity (or marrow cavity). The wall of the diaphysis is made up of compact bone, which is dense … WebRecall that when the long bones formed, a disk of hyaline cartilage remained between the diaphysis and the epiphyses of the bone. This cartilage continues to grow by interstitial cartilage growth allowing the bone to increase in length. At the same time, endochondral ossification continues in the diaphysis.
